Everyone likes an underdog story. We all can relate on a certain level to the experience of overcoming the odds to achieve a goal. It is those victories that seem to taste sweeter. For Rodney Simmons, that revolved around building a pure RV repair model that is focused on helping owners get maximum enjoyment of their RV. He aimed to accomplish this with integrity and a high level of expertise. He made a simple start with one truck. A journey of 28 years began with that truck and that man. To provide perspective on life the year Blue moon RV started, smartphones were not even a thing and Blockbuster video was the place to go to rent videos. Much has changed since then. Blue Moon RV has assisted over 100,000 RV owners and commercial operators. Even more impressive is that 80% of our customers use only Blue Moon RV Time and again.
Blue Moon Mobile RV began in 1996 with one small truck and one service technician. Through determination and honoring our words with actions, we have become the go-to on-site RV service in all of northern Texas. Our RV service trucks, manned by certified and master-certified RV technicians, provide RV repair to all areas of northern central Texas including Dallas, Fort Worth, Plano, Arlington, Denton, Frisco, Allen, McKinney, North Lake, Keller, Grapevine, Trophy Club, Prosper, and many outlying cities.
For your benefit, we have factory-trained and master-certified technicians ready to provide courteous, professional, and dependable on-site and in-shop services. Rod Rod da RV Gawd
Rodney began his career over 40 years ago and has been a technician at such notable service stand outs such as Foretravel and Buddy Gregg. He is a colorful character with a complete inability to do anything halfheartedly. He has a true passion for RV’s and their owners. He is a fan favorite because of the time he spends with each client. If Rodney is working on your RV, which he still does at a spry 64, you will get calls from him updating you. He is the guy who always reads the manual, terms, conditions, and fine print. He doesn’t just read these details. He understands them. This attention to detail doesn’t slow him down at all!
If you have met him, you know that he goes 100 miles per hour all the time.
After using his mechanical aptitude in the oil field as a young man, he transitioned to the RV industry with only a bag of tools. The work suited him well and the endless supply of puzzles that is RV repair challenged him in a special way. He sought out training in every form. Rodney has been recognized as an expert witness in Texas and Florida. He served as past chair of the education committee for the Texas Recreational Vehicle Association (TRVA). He positioned Blue Moon RV as early subject matter experts by earning Dometic service center of the year and becoming an authorized service center for every manufacturer of systems found on most RV’s. Beyond that he worked to gain an expert understanding of electrical, hydraulics, plumbing, construction, power generation, HVAC, and much more.
Rodney was raised in West Texas and tagged along with his grandad to his first oil well at 7 years old. He comes from a very mechanical family. He lived in Alpine, Terlingua, Midland, Houston, and Dallas. Rodney is a family man with 4 grandchildren, 2 daughters, and one stepson. Anything he does, he does as a master. He is an excellent gardener, the king of the grill and breakfast, the world’s best home maintenance man, and science geek. This character never stops working to improve and learn, even taking up guitar in his 60’s.

Robert joined Blue Moon RV over 25 years ago as a mobile tech. A Steamboat Springs, CO native and son of an appliance repairman, Robert transitioned well to RV repair. As a child he tagged along with his father who served multiple counties. While most kids played with toys, Robert played with and could use a multimeter. Like many at Blue Moon RV, he is an RV guru of the highest order. If you ask Robert a question, be prepared for the complete answer. It is for this reason we still use him to assist with informing us on complex repairs. Robert is where we go for the hard questions. He is also a customer favorite for parts sourcing and advising.
Robert is a generous individual at work and at home. He serves his church by implementing their audio-visual program and is there weekly to man it. He is married to his college sweetheart and love of his life.

Jaxon started the apprentice program when the curriculum was only 1 page. It now spans an entire excel workbook and is facilitgated with a Google Classroom. At his official graduation, he had approximately 5000 hours of contact time and every certification available.
Jaxon’s work is impeccable. We say he disappears to Narnia and shows up at day’s end after having been very productive. Many of our most complex repairs are spearheaded by him. He also is a highly experienced boilermaker, (a four-year degree in Australia). He is the mentor that the newbies go to after Adrian gently and patiently gives them the basics. When they get promoted to Jaxon, the rubber meets the road. While Jaxon is “No worries, mate” about many things, he takes his work very seriously. One thing we all noticed about Jaxon was he was willing to learn from all the mentors and even learned which was the best place to go for information. This behavior served to accelerate his learning and mastery.
